WebThe WSIB is entirely funded by employers. The head office of the WSIB is in Toronto and is supplemented by district and area offices throughout the province. Web29 jul. 2024 · To calculate the WSIB Premium Remittance, you must at first add up the gross insurable earnings for all the workers under your organization for the certain reporting period. This amount should be filled in column A. Next, multiply the number you’ve got in column A by the WSIB rate specified in column B. WebOn January 1, 2024 Ontario’s Workplace Safety Insurance Board (WSIB) introduced a new rate model for setting employer premiums. WSIB is an arm’s length provincial agency responsible for workplace compensation claims. Like other workplace compensation agencies in Canada, it is funded by employer premiums and administration fees.
